Job Description Summary The Associate Director of NPS Vendor Operations will be responsible for the day-to-day oversight of an assigned group of vendor accounts that are providing services – hub, co-pay, adherence, free goods, digital, etc. – to the Novartis Patient Support (NPS) organization. He / she will serve as the single point of contact to manage vendor deliverables and performance. This candidate will re-quire strong collaboration and prioritization skills to drive alignment across vendors and internal stakeholders, while managing multiple initiatives across several therapeutic areas. The location for this role is East Hanover, NJ. The expectation of working hours and travel (domestic and/or international) will be defined by the hiring manager. This position will require 20% travel. Job Description This individual will work closely with NPS Disease Area & Product, Process Mapping, Requirements & Improvement, Quality, Enterprise Content Design, as well as Novartis Innovative Medicines Procurement, Contracting, Finance, Legal, Privacy and Compliance partners. Major Accountabilities: Serve as program owner and single point of contact for day-to-day vendor operations across a combination of key vendors / therapeutic areas, while managing all internal processes and governance protocols as they pertain to vendor management Partner with NPS stakeholders, procurement and contracting to develop or renew statements of work (SOW) and task orders (TO), scoping out vendor budgets, key deliverables etc. Align with NPS Disease Area & Product and NPS Product teams to understand priorities and program design & strategy based on customer & patient needs, targeted outcomes, market events etc. Collaborate with NPS Process Mapping, Requirements and Improvement to create standardized vendor business requirements documents (BRDs), while aligning with NPS Disease Area & Product operations and Enterprise Content Design to ensure vendor priorities, assets and milestones are up to date Own development, execution, approvals, change management and version control processes for vendor BRDs, and ensure they align with vendor standard operating procedures (SOPs) and process flows Plan and project manage execution of prioritized vendor milestones and deliverables, communicating status and risks across stakeholder matrix Education: Bachelor degree required Advanced degree (MA, MS or MBA) preferred Required Experience: 5 years of healthcare system, account or vendor management experience, including direct pharmaceutical experience in patient services 3 years of program operations management experience Significant experience in project managing vendor onboarding, change management / transitions and milestone delivery Strong planning, organization, communication and problem-solving / escalation resolution skills. Proven ability to collaborate cross-functionally within and across internal functions Demonstrated ability monitor program performance and develop data-driven diagnostics and recommendations Customer focused with ability to develop long-term relationships with stakeholders and gain their trust and respect.
